User Guide
This user guide explains how to access Notion, create and import content, use AI features, and export or share pages.

Access Notion Website
- Navigate to: https://www.notion.com;
- Click Get Notion free or Log in;
- Register using a Google account, Apple account, Microsoft Account, or email address;
- After logging in, the main workspace will be displayed.
Create Notes and Import Documents
- Click the Edit icon (Create New Page button) on the top of the left sidebar to create a new note;
- Enter a title for the new page and start typing directly in the page;
- To import existing documents, click the three-dot icon (More button) on the upper-right corner, and select Import from the dropdown panel;
- Select the application or file type in the pop-up window; (Notes: Supports import from CSV, PDF, Markdown, HTML, Word, Google Docs, Trello, etc.)
- To insert blocks, media, embeds, or files: Click the + button at the left side of each line, or press the / key.
(Notes: Blocks include To-do list, Quote, Table, Divider, Link to page, etc.)
AI Writing Assistant
- Press the spacebar on a new line within a page and enter a prompt to activate the Notion AI assistant;
- To edit existing text, highlight the desired content and click Improve writing in the appearing menu;
- After the improved version appears, select Accept, Discard, Insert below, or Try again in the appearing menu;
- Press the Space key in an empty line to select AI functions;
- Choose from options like Continue writing, Add a summary, Brainstorm ideas, or Generate a flowchart;
- Select an AI function and click the Send icon to use the function.
Export and Share
- Navigate to the desired page and click the three-dot menu (...) in the top-right corner;
- Select Export from the dropdown menu;
- Choose the desired export format (PDF, HTML, or Markdown & CSV) in the pop-up window;
- Adjust any additional settings and click the Export button to download the file;
- To share a page, click the Share button in the top-right corner;
- Click Copy Link to get the shareable link.
Educational Scenarios
Departmental Course Resources
A history department can enhance its educational offerings by building a Notion wiki dedicated to archival resources. Faculty members can upload digitized primary sources, such as historical documents, photographs, and maps, and tag them by course codes to facilitate easy access and integration into the curriculum. The use of Notion's tagging and organizational features enables educators to create thematic collections that align with specific course objectives. This digital archive can serve as a dynamic, evolving resource that grows with each academic year, potentially transforming into a comprehensive digital library that supports both teaching and research endeavors. Additionally, this system can be leveraged to track the usage of materials across courses, providing valuable insights into curriculum development and student engagement with primary sources.
Research Lab Management
A research lab can optimize its operations by using Notion to track experiment protocols and equipment logs. By creating shared databases, lab members can efficiently manage the booking and usage of equipment among researchers, ensuring that resources are allocated effectively and minimizing scheduling conflicts. Notion's database capabilities allow for detailed documentation of experiment protocols, including step-by-step procedures, safety guidelines, and troubleshooting tips. The collaborative features of Notion facilitate communication and coordination among lab members. By providing real-time updates on equipment availability and usage, researchers can plan their experiments more effectively and optimize their time in the lab. Furthermore, the structured data within Notion can be leveraged for generating reports, tracking project progress, and even supporting grant applications by providing comprehensive overviews of lab activities and resource utilization.

Thesis Writing Hub
A graduate student can significantly enhance their thesis writing process by creating a comprehensive Notion workspace. This digital hub can include interconnected pages for each chapter, citations, and advisor feedback. By sharing specific pages with their advisor, students can facilitate real-time annotations and feedback, eliminating the risk of losing important information in email exchanges. This collaborative setup not only enhances communication between the student and advisor but also provides a clear audit trail of revisions and suggestions. The ability to integrate various types of content, such as research articles, multimedia resources, and personal notes, within Notion supports a holistic approach to thesis development. The interconnected nature of these pages allows for seamless navigation between different aspects of the thesis, promoting a holistic view of the project. By utilizing Notion's relational database features, the student can create dynamic links between chapters, sources, and ideas, facilitating a more integrated approach to academic writing.
Capstone Project Collaboration
Engineering students working on a capstone project can leverage Notion to co-manage their collaborative efforts effectively. By creating a shared Notion board, they can organize tasks, track progress, and ensure accountability among team members. The integration of tools like Figma allows for seamless feedback on design elements, fostering a dynamic and iterative development process. Additionally, embedding Google Calendar within the Notion workspace helps students stay on top of important deadlines and meetings. Notion's flexible structure allows the students to create custom views for different aspects of their project, such as a Kanban board for task management, a gallery view for design iterations, and a timeline view for project progression. Furthermore, by utilizing Notion's database features, students can create interconnected pages for tracking project resources, documenting research findings, and managing project deliverables. The shared Notion workspace becomes a living document of the team's collective knowledge and progress, serving as both a project management tool and a learning resource for future engineering students undertaking similar capstone projects.
